Continuous Monitoring for Better Outcomes

At the heart of PetPace is continuous, non-invasive monitoring of core physiological signals. The PetPace collar tracks heart rate, respiration, body temperature, and general activity patterns to build a comprehensive picture of a pet’s day-to-day health and behavior. Rather than relying on occasional clinic visits or subjective observations, continuous monitoring provides objective data that can reveal subtle changes over time.

AI-Driven Analysis That Supports Early Detection

PetPace combines sensor data with AI-based analysis to identify patterns that may indicate pain, stress, or the early stages of illness. By analyzing trends and deviations from an individual pet’s baseline, the system helps pet owners and veterinarians detect potential problems earlier, enabling more timely interventions. Early detection often leads to less invasive treatment, faster recovery, and better long-term outcomes for pets.

Empowering Pet Owners and Veterinarians

One of the biggest advantages of smart collars like PetPace is the way they bridge communication between pet owners and veterinary professionals. Reliable, continuous data gives owners increased confidence in understanding their pet’s condition and helps veterinarians make better-informed recommendations. This supports a more proactive and preventive approach to care, where small changes in health or behavior can be addressed before becoming major issues.

Design and Practical Benefits

PetPace V3.0 was designed with daily life in mind: it aims to be comfortable for pets to wear while delivering clinically useful information. The collar focuses on gathering meaningful metrics without interfering with normal activity, so owners can keep a close eye on their pet’s wellbeing without frequent manual checks. This continuous data stream creates a reliable medical record that can be referenced over time to track recovery, monitor chronic conditions, or evaluate the effectiveness of treatments.
